About Investment Law in Ireland

Investment law in Ireland governs the rules and regulations surrounding investing in various financial instruments such as stocks, bonds, and real estate. It is essential to have a good understanding of these laws to protect your investments and ensure compliance with the legal requirements.

Why You May Need a Lawyer

There are several situations where you may need a lawyer specializing in investment law in Ireland. These include disputes with brokers or financial institutions, regulatory investigations, contract negotiations, and creating investment strategies to maximize returns while minimizing risks. A lawyer can provide valuable guidance and representation to protect your interests in these complex matters.

Local Laws Overview

Some key aspects of local laws relevant to investment in Ireland include financial regulation by the Central Bank of Ireland, tax laws on capital gains and income from investments, and rules governing the establishment and operation of investment funds. It is crucial to stay informed about these laws to make informed investment decisions and comply with legal requirements.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What are the different types of investment vehicles available in Ireland?

There are various types of investment vehicles in Ireland, including stocks, bonds, mutual funds, real estate, and alternative investments such as cryptocurrencies and peer-to-peer lending platforms.

2. How can I protect my investments from fraud or misconduct?

You can protect your investments by conducting thorough due diligence on investment opportunities, working with reputable financial advisors or brokers, and monitoring your investment accounts regularly for any suspicious activity.

3. What are the tax implications of investing in Ireland?

Investors in Ireland are subject to capital gains tax on profits from investments, as well as income tax on dividends and interest earned. It is advisable to consult with a tax advisor to understand the tax implications of your investments.

4. How can I resolve a dispute with my investment broker?

If you have a dispute with your investment broker, you can try to resolve it through mediation or arbitration. If these methods fail, you may need to seek legal assistance to take the matter to court.

5. What is the role of the Central Bank of Ireland in regulating investments?

The Central Bank of Ireland regulates financial institutions and investment firms operating in Ireland to ensure they comply with laws and regulations, protect investors' interests, and maintain the stability of the financial system.

6. How can I evaluate the risks and returns of an investment opportunity?

You can evaluate the risks and returns of an investment opportunity by conducting thorough research, assessing your risk tolerance, considering the investment's historical performance, and seeking advice from financial professionals.

7. Are there any restrictions on foreign investments in Ireland?

Foreign investments in Ireland are generally welcome, but certain sectors such as national security or strategic industries may be subject to restrictions or approval requirements. It is advisable to consult with legal experts to understand any restrictions that may apply to your investment.

8. Can I invest in cryptocurrencies in Ireland?

Yes, you can invest in cryptocurrencies in Ireland, but you should be aware of the regulatory environment and tax implications of cryptocurrency investments. It is advisable to seek advice from financial and legal professionals before investing in cryptocurrencies.

9. What are the key factors to consider when creating an investment portfolio?

When creating an investment portfolio, you should consider your financial goals, risk tolerance, investment time horizon, diversification across asset classes, and monitoring and rebalancing your portfolio regularly to achieve your investment objectives.

10. How can I stay informed about changes in investment laws and regulations in Ireland?

You can stay informed about changes in investment laws and regulations in Ireland by following updates from the Central Bank of Ireland, consulting legal and financial news sources, and seeking advice from legal professionals specializing in investment law.
